Acknowledgment

The acknowledgment section may be used to express gratitude to individuals who contributed significantly to the publication of the work but do not meet the criteria for authorship. This section may also include relevant financial disclosures. Contributors who satisfy authorship requirements should not be listed in the acknowledgments.

Acknowledgment Guidelines

  • Authors should carefully assess contributions and authorship standards, particularly in multi-regional collaborations, to ensure equitable recognition of all researchers, including local collaborators.
  • Acknowledgments should be concise and should not mention anonymous referees, editors, or include unnecessary statements.
  • Financial acknowledgments should reference only those grants or funders that directly supported the work or contributed substantially to the publication.
